Background
Harvey, Charles Albert was born on September 28, 1949 in Beverly, Massachusetts, United States. Son of Charles A. and Phyllis B. (O'Rourke) Harvey.

Assumption College (Bachelor of Arts, 1971). University of Maine (Juris Doctor, 1974). Editor-in-Chief, Maine Law Review, 1973-1974.
Associate Verrill & Dana, Portland, Maine, 1974-1979, partner, 1979-1995, Harvey & Frank, Portland, since 1995. Associate chief counsel President's Commission on Accident at Three Mile Island, Washington, 1979. Member advisory committee on civil rules Maine Supreme Judicial Court, 1978-1991, chairman advisory committee on cameras in trial courts, 1991-1993, consultant on civil rules, since 1996, chairman advisory committee on civil rules, 1987-1991.
Chairman advisory committee on local rules United States District Court Maine, since 1985, member civil justice advisory committee, 1992-1997. Chairman Maine Governor's Select Committee on Judicial Appointments, 1987-1991. Member Senator Olympia J. Snowe's advisory committee on appointment of the United States District Judge, United States Attorney and United States Marshal, 2001-2002.
Chairman grievance commission Maine Board Overseers of the Bar, 1996-1997.
Contributor articles to professional journals.

Trustee Portland Sympnony Orchestra, 1980-1989, president, 1987-1989, advisory trustee, since 1989. Trustee Portland Stage Company, 1984-1987, advisory trustee, since 1987. Trustee Waynflete School, 1990-1996.
Advisory trustee Maine Childrens Museum, 1992-1999, Maine Volunteer Lawyers for the Arts, 1994-1999. Fellow American College Trial Lawyers, Maine Bar Foundation. Member American Law Institute.
Married Whitney Ann Neville, September 21, 1985. Children: John Whitney, Charlotte Baird.
